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to a higher level, often to prevent flood damage or to comply with local regulations. This process typically includes lifting the entire building, then adding a new foundation or supporting structure beneath it.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ment and techniques to ensure the building is securely raised without damage. Once the structure is at the desired height, new foundations are installed, and the building is carefully lowered onto them, creating a stable and elevated property.

Foundation Raising Costs - Typical expenses range from $10,000 to $30,000 depending on the size and complexity of the project, with example costs around $15,000 for a standard home.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Permitting and Inspection Fees - These fees generally fall between $500 and $2,000, varying by location and project scope. Costs may include permits, inspection fees, and related administrative charges.
Additional Materials and Equipment - Expenses for materials such as temporary supports, lifting equipment, and foundation materials can range from $2,000 to $8,000. The total depends on the building size and the extent of the raising process.
Labor and Contractor Fees - Labor costs typically range from $5,000 to $20,000, influenced by project complexity and local labor rates. Contractors charge based on the scope of work and duration of the project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
